The tag of India's first-ever superstar is associated with none other than Rajesh Khanna. The iconic late actor left no stone unturned in entertaining fans to the fullest. With movies like Aradhana, Anand, Amar Prem, Namak Haraam, Avishkaar, The Train, among others, Rajesh Khanna is known for his performances, even more than a decade after his passing. Fondly called Kaka, Khanna's professional life was celebrated, while his personal life also made headlines. Rajesh was married to actress Dimple Kapadia. The actress was hardly 15 when she tied the knot with the superstar. However, their wedding did not last long, and they eventually separated. Though the couple went their separate ways, they never formally divorced until his demise in 2012. A video that has resurfaced online shows Kaka reflecting on Dimple's decision not to grant him a divorce. The video is now making the rounds on the internet. Rajesh Khanna, in the video, can be heard saying, 'We did live separately. Abhi tak divorce nahi diya. (She has not given me a divorce yet). She doesn't give reasons—best known to her. I can only say that she chose not to get a divorce. It's her choice. Dilon ki baat hai (It is a matter of the heart). The knots and seven pheras are part of an institution of marriage that seems outdated in today's modern times, as per many people. Some people share, while others don't disclose.' Rajesh Khanna's love life was known to all. After separating from Dimple Kapadia, rumours made headlines that Kaka was romantically involved with Tina Munim (now Tina Ambani). However, one of his iconic affairs—which was not hidden from anyone—was with Anju Mahendru. Though Kaka and Anju were never married, they had a live-in relationship. Media reports claim that Kaka did propose to Anju for marriage even before getting married to Dimple. However, the actress turned down the offer, saying that she wanted to focus on her career at that point in time and was not ready for marriage.

Rajesh Khanna was that star of stars. In the Bollywood industry, where stardom often fades with time, it was Rajesh Khanna's fame that remained evergreen. From Aradhana, Anand, Amar Prem, to Namak Haraam, Avishkaar, The Train, among others, Rajesh Khanna delivered superhit movies that the industry still remembers. Fondly called Kaka, Rajesh's professional life always remained in the headlines. However, it was his personal life that made fans curious too. Rajesh Khanna's controversial love affair was known to all. From marrying Dimple Kapadia at a young age to having a relationship with Tina Munim (now Tina Ambani), Kaka's love life was famous in every state of the nation. However, do you know that there was a person in Kaka's life who, though not married to him, remained with him just like a wife? Yes, the person here in discussion is veteran actress Anju Mahendru. Rajesh and Anju lived together like husband and wife for a long time, which is today called live-in. Rajesh Khanna's co-star Mumtaz revealed this secret relationship of Rajesh Khanna. In a podcast, Mumtaz clearly stated that Rajesh and Anju did not consider themselves less than husband and wife. Mumtaz said, 'Rajesh and Anju lived in the same house like husband and wife, they used to get up and sit together, eat and drink together — their relationship was no less than that of a husband and wife.' The veteran actress added, 'Yes, both of them were not married, but this relationship was no less than a marriage. They both loved each other very much.' It is worth noting that Rajesh's mother wanted him to get married soon, because he was 27 years old at that time. But when Rajesh proposed to Anju in 1971, she said that she wanted to postpone their marriage because she wanted to focus on building her career as an actress.
